Former Selector Devang Gandhi Backs Shubman Gill for Vice-Captaincy Ahead of Asia Cup 2025
Amidst the anticipation surrounding the upcoming Asia Cup 2025 team selections, former Indian selector Devang Gandhi has thrown his support behind Shubman Gill for the vice-captaincy role in the Indian T20I side. With the recent announcement of Suryakumar Yadav as the T20I skipper following Rohit Sharma’s retirement, the spotlight has shifted to Gill’s potential leadership role in the team.
Gill’s Journey to Vice-Captaincy Consideration
Shubman Gill, a talented young batter, last donned the Indian colors in the T20 format during the Sri Lanka series in 2024. Despite his absence from subsequent series against Bangladesh, South Africa, and England, Gill has been making waves in the IPL as the skipper of Gujarat Titans, showcasing his leadership qualities and batting prowess.
Former selector Devang Gandhi emphasized Gill’s consistency and performance, stating, “Don’t forget that he was not dropped when India was playing T20 cricket in South Africa towards the end of the year, a series India won 3-1.” Gandhi believes that Gill’s success in the IPL positions him as the ideal candidate for the vice-captaincy role in the upcoming Asia Cup.
Varied Opinions Among Former Players
As discussions heat up around Gill’s potential appointment, former teammates Mohammed Kaif and Harbhajan Singh have differing views on the matter. While Harbhajan Singh, who played alongside Gill in KKR, supports the young talent’s inclusion in the playing XI for the Asia Cup, Kaif has opted to keep him in the squad but not the final XI.
